Title: Unveiling the Innovative Mind of Inventor Christina Erb

Introduction: Christina Erb, a prolific inventor based in Kriftel, Germany, has secured an impressive 35 patents throughout her career. Her groundbreaking work in the fields of heteroaryl carboxamides and amides of acetic and propionic acids has significantly contributed to advancements in medicine and cognitive enhancement.

Latest Patents: Among her latest patents, Christina Erb has focused on the development of novel heteroaryl carboxamides. These compounds are integral in the production of medicaments aimed at treating and preventing various diseases, while also enhancing perception, concentration, learning, and memory. Additionally, her innovations in amides of acetic and propionic acids have paved the way for the creation of medications that cater to similar therapeutic and cognitive needs.

Career Highlights: Christina Erb has lent her expertise to renowned companies such as Bayer Intellectual Property GmbH and Boehringer Ingelheim International GmbH.
